The Ogun State Federal Road Safety Corps (FRSC) confirmed on Tuesday that one person has been pronounced dead while five others sustained varying degrees of injury in a lone accident that occurred along the Lagos-Ibadan Expressway on Tuesday.

The accident, according to the FRSC, involved 23 people who happened to be all male.

The spokesperson for the Ogun State Command of the Federal Road Safety Corps, Florence Okpe, who spoke to newsmen, revealed that the accident occurred around the Fidiwo axis of the expressway.

She further revealed that it was a lone crash involving a truck that was travelling at high speed before its tyre burst.

Explaining the cause of the crash, Okpe noted that the primary cause was over-speeding which led to the bursting of the tyre.

She said, “23 persons involved, all male, five injured and one person killed. It was a lone crash involving a truck. The cause of the crash was tyre bust and speeding.”

She also advised motorists and road users to adhere to safety precautions and avoid over-speeding so as to secure their lives.

“Motorists are advised to always drive with caution on the expressway so as to prevent needless loss of lives,” Okpe said.

 

News About Nigeria reports that Lagos-Ibadan Expressway have become a death trap and an accident zone in recent times.

A similar tragic incident occured on the Expressway among many others on the 13th of February, 2024 which claimed the lives of five persons and left 12 people injured.

According to reports, the accident involved a Mazda bus and a Howo truck.

The driver of the Mazda bus was said to have fell asleep due to fatigue, lost control in the process, and rammed into the moving truck.
